Responsibilities
- Provide direct, compassionate patient care including bathing, dressing, and grooming assistance.
- Monitor and record vital signs (blood pressure, pulse, temperature, respiration rate) accurately.
- Assist patients with mobility, transfers, and ambulation using proper body mechanics and assistive devices.
- Administer medications and treatments as prescribed by the RN or LPN, strictly adhering to safety protocols.
- Communicate effectively with patients, families, and the interdisciplinary care team regarding patient status.
- Maintain a clean, sanitary, and organized patient environment to prevent infection and ensure safety.
- Respond promptly to patient calls and emergencies, following hospital protocols.
